September's PS+ Games

inFAMOUS: Second Son (PS4)
Child of Light (PS4)
RIGS: Mechanised Combat League (PS4 bonus title – PS VR required)
That’s You (PS4 bonus title)
Truck Racer (PS3)
Handball 2016 (PS3)
We Are Doomed (PS Vita & PS4)
Hatoful Boyfriend (PS4 & PS Vita)
